queenofclean --- 9 years ago -

We saw Penn and Teller and they were fantastic! They also go outside the Theatre after every show and sign autographs and take selfies with your phone and they stay until everyone sees them that wants to. They were awesome.

We then saw Blue Man group and it was AMAZING, it was funny and crazy and my husband and I both loved it. There is not a bad seat in the theatre.

We also went to Brad Garretts Comedy club, if Brad is there do NOT sit up front because his whole bit is insult comedy to the ones in front. The headliner was awesome and it was a lot of fun.

I bought Penn and Teller online before we went because it was out first night but I got the other show tickets from the yellow same day discount ticket booths that are everywhere and saved almost 175 doing so. They have all the shows at discount rates.

Have fun! Bring tennis shoes, there is a lot of walking! We used Lyft for some awesome deals instead of cabs or uber.
